WASHINGTON, June 7, 2012 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- Home remedies for jellyfish stings - such as vinegar, alcohol, meat tenderizer, baking soda and urine -may be less effective at relieving pain than plain hot water and lidocaine, according to a paper published online Tuesday in Annals of Emergency Medicine ("Evidence-Based Treatment of Jellyfish Stings in North America and Hawaii") http://www.annemergmed.com/webfiles/images/journals/ymem/ntward.pdf. New research from the University of California shows how the ability to detect light could have evolved before anything like an eye. As published today (March 5) in the journal BMC Biology, the research is based on the stinging mechanism in the tiny, brainless and eyeless freshwater polyp Hydra magnipapillata. Clashing colonies of sea anemones fight as organized armies with distinct castes of warriors, scouts, reproductives and other types, according to a new study.The sea anemone Anthopleura elegantissima lives in large colonies of genetically identical clones on boulders around the tide line. Where two colonies meet they form a distinct boundary zone. The Black Sea nettle (Chrysaora achlyos) or sometimes known as the Black jellyfish is known for its dark coloration. This species of jellyfish is found in the Pacific Ocean. There have been reports or sighting of the black jellyfish as for north as British Columbia but its range is mostly thought to be from the north in Monterey Bay, to the southern shores of Baja California and Mexico.
